Did anyone put together a master list of which Lego products are being ripped from Amazon?  I assume individually we only know the ones we "have listed already".  Have a bunch of stuff I'm waiting for the 4th quarter but maybe I should be unloading now . . .

Posted
9 minutes ago, gmpirate said:

Did anyone put together a master list of which Lego products are being ripped from Amazon?  I assume individually we only know the ones we "have listed already".  Have a bunch of stuff I'm waiting for the 4th quarter but maybe I should be unloading now . . .

It is pretty much alt listings, gwp and exclusives ( target, walmart, etc )  that Amazon.com never sold.

39 minutes ago, Bricklectic said:

What does everyone do for FBA discrepancy when purchased through retail? Has anyone successfully used Walmart and Target receipts for reimbursement?

 

Yes, they usually do . They only reimburse cost now 

Posted
32 minutes ago, Bold-Arrow said:

Yes, they usually do . They only reimburse cost now 

Thanks! My main concern isnt Amazon turning me down. Rather questioning my ungating status if my receipt shows Walmart.

 

In general, all submitted invoices are part of your permanent record. Anytime amazon wants to conduct a wave of new gating they can look at the body of your submissions. Not sure if this thought process is paranoia or smart 

Posted
2 minutes ago, Bricklectic said:

Thanks! My main concern isnt Amazon turning me down. Rather questioning my ungating status if my receipt shows Walmart.

 

In general, all submitted invoices are part of your permanent record. Anytime amazon wants to conduct a wave of new gating they can look at the body of your submissions. Not sure if this thought process is paranoia or smart 

I don’t think you really need to worry about that. Amazon knows that there are no legitimate distributors of Lego as per their policy. 
but yes , anything you submit to Amazon is there forever. I know ppl getting caught submitting the same invoice that they submitted years ago and just changed the date on it
